The Goshen Irrigation District reported this week it has 51,161 acre-feet of water in storage as of March 11, enough to supply approximately 40 days of irrigation for the district.

HARTVILLE, Wyo. – Author Kathryn Campbell Kelly will present her book “I Can Never Forget It: Tragedy at Cottonwood Creek – Dakota Territory 1865” at 6 p.m. Thursday, March 26 at Hartville City Hall.
